The UAE Government Media Office has documented the second edition of the World's Coolest Winter campaign through the eyes of a visually impaired child.
The emotional uplifting film, "A Winter through My Eyes", released on social media, tells the story of 11-year-old Clara, who was flown to the UAE for her first trip abroad.
She got the chance to experience the country’s distinctive destinations and hospitality during the one-week long all-expenses paid trip across the seven Emirates.
A production crew documented Clara's emotions and journey into a compelling story that shows her unique, unfiltered, and authentic perspective.
Sharing her experience, Clara said, "This winter the UAE was the first country I’ve ever travelled to. And in one just week I’ve enjoyed an entire lifetime."
"You know what I learnt, when you really want to feel something, you don’t need to look with your eyes, you need to look with your heart. So, even if I cannot see, it’s everything I have felt here that has helped me see so much more," she added.
